It is never pleasant to undergo medical treatments, and for children in particular the experience can be daunting or frightening. The Anouk Foundation, named after an inspiring girl with special needs, is a Swiss-based organization that draws upon teams of artists, in collaboration with medical staff, to create bright and cheerful murals on the walls of medical institutions, creating a more vibrant atmosphere and lessening the fear of medical interventions. The Trafigura Foundation has supported Anouk since 2012 and is now extending its support to a new series of paintings in a hospital in Huelva, Spain. Here, bright pictures on the walls will give a more cheerful outlook to children in RioTinto’s paediatric unit.
